If you need a portable keyboard for real travel work, treat it like a business tool, not a nice extra. When a keyboard drops its connection, runs flat, or gets damaged in transit, work slows down or stops. A sleeve or stand is helpful, but your keyboard can still be a single point of failure. Start with the basics. Is it a sturdy one-piece design, does it charge over USB-C, and is the battery built for multi-day use? A keyboard that lives in a carry-on deals with pressure, torsion, and impact all the time, so build quality is not cosmetic. The real question is failure risk. Foldable designs add hinge and cable weak points, which matters if you rely on one board every day.
Check whether it handles practical switching between your laptop, tablet, and phone. The point is not the feature list. It is whether you can move between devices without breaking momentum.
Judge comfort in plain terms: key spacing, key feel, and whether you can type through a long session without strain. Backlighting matters because it supports productivity in different environments. What matters is comfort that still holds up during real work sessions.

Before your return window closes, test wake-from-sleep, Bluetooth off/on recovery, and switching across the devices you actually carry. You are checking whether reconnecting feels quick enough to resume work without friction.
Check for light chassis twist, corner/deck creak, and key wobble consistency across the board. Travel means repeated pressure, torsion, and impact, so visible rigidity matters more than branding language. If spill or ingress protection is mentioned, confirm the exact wording in the manual or product details. A cover or rigid case also helps protect against bag compression.
USB-C is the practical default because it simplifies charging in transit. Confirm you can keep working while plugged in, and verify battery-status visibility in the documentation or support pages. If charging speed matters for short top-ups, verify that before you rely on it.
Foldables can work for some travelers, but hinges and flexible internal cables add mechanical exposure. A single-piece build is usually the lower-risk default when this is your primary daily work keyboard.
| Factor | Single-piece keyboard | Foldable keyboard | Decision rule |
|---|---|---|---|
| Reliability exposure | Fewer moving parts | More moving/flex points | If this is your primary work board, default to single-piece |
| Repairability confidence | Limited pre-purchase certainty | Limited pre-purchase certainty, plus hinge/cable uncertainty | If parts/service details are unclear, assume replacement risk |
| Typing consistency | Usually more stable feel/layout | May involve layout or feel compromises | If you type for long sessions, favor the rigid option |
| Packability | Compact for most bags | Better for very tight packing constraints | Choose foldable only when size savings materially changes your setup |
Final filter: if a listing is vague about charging port type, battery behavior, and build details, skip it. Reliable choices are usually the ones with clear, verifiable product information.

After reliability, your biggest speed gain comes from removing switching friction between devices. In practice, the better keyboard is usually the one that lets you move cleanly between your laptop, tablet, and phone with minimal setup drag.
| Test point | What to look for | Friction sign |
|---|---|---|
| Pairing reliability | Your real sequence works: laptop -> tablet -> phone -> laptop | Re-pairing before a client reply |
| Switch awkwardness | Switching feels routine enough that you stop noticing it | Extra button presses or setup drag |
| Reconnection after sleep | Input resumes cleanly after devices sleep | Missed early keystrokes after reconnect |
| Consistency across devices | Behavior stays stable on laptop, tablet, and phone | Input does not follow to your tablet or resumes inconsistently |
Your admin tax shows up in small delays: re-pairing before a client reply, tapping on-screen because input did not follow to your tablet, or breaking writing flow to answer on your phone. Multi-device switching matters because it turns those devices into one workable system. Judge it by feel: if switching is routine enough that you stop noticing it, it is doing its job.
Before your return window closes, run your real sequence: laptop -> tablet -> phone -> laptop. Check four observable points: pairing reliability, switch awkwardness, reconnection after sleep, and consistency across all three device types. If any step repeatedly stalls, that is daily friction, regardless of the spec sheet.
Velocity losses usually come from repeated half-failures, not full disconnects. You see it when a device reconnects but misses early keystrokes, needs extra button presses, or resumes inconsistently.
Verify details in the product page, manual, or support docs: device switching behavior, USB-C charging, backlighting, and battery behavior. If "multi-device" is listed without clear switching instructions or sleep-reconnect behavior, treat it as unverified. Also confirm charge-while-typing and clear battery status so low power does not interrupt active work.

Your best travel keyboard is the one you can use for long sessions with steady output and low fatigue, and that usually comes down to fit, size class, and lighting control.
| Check | What to test | Warning sign |
|---|---|---|
| Key spacing comfort | Type at normal speed on the smallest surface you actually use | Frequent key collisions |
| Layout familiarity | Check Backspace, Enter, arrows, and Fn combos where your hands expect them | Backspace, Enter, arrows, or Fn combos are not where your hands expect them |
| Wrist posture on small surfaces | Use it on café or tray tables and see whether the position is sustainable | The board sits in a position you cannot sustain |
| Prolonged typing tolerance | Do 20 to 30 minutes of real work | Missed keys, finger tension, or early fatigue |
Scissor and mechanical keyboards differ in feel, height, and sound, but neither is automatically better. For client-facing days, test in shared or quiet spaces and choose what stays unobtrusive. For writing-heavy days, choose the option that keeps your pace steady with fewer corrections. For coding-heavy work, prioritize layout familiarity, arrow access, and comfortable modifier use over switch category.
Test on the smallest surface you actually use, not just your home desk.
Compact keyboards are smaller and lighter than full-size models, easier to carry, and can free desk space for a mouse or accessories. But smaller layouts can add friction in longer sessions if key access depends too much on layers.
| Size class | When it usually fits | What to verify |
|---|---|---|
| 60% | Tight packing limits, frequent transit, shorter work bursts | Whether missing dedicated arrows/function keys slows long sessions |
| 65% | Mixed travel with regular writing | Whether the right-side cluster feels cramped over time |
| 75% | Longer drafts and heavier document work with compact carry | Whether footprint still works on your smallest surfaces |
| TKL | Longer stays and more desk-based work | Whether extra width is worth daily carry |
A practical caution: foldable keyboards can introduce added hinge and internal cable risk compared with single-piece designs.
Backlighting can support productivity across changing environments, but usability is what matters: can you set brightness low enough to limit glare and high enough to read legends clearly at your normal angle? Check the product page, manual, or support docs for brightness behavior, timeout behavior, USB-C charging, and battery notes with lighting enabled. If details are vague, treat battery impact as unverified and verify charging behavior before you rely on it.

Here is the practical read on each option after the table narrows your list.
Logitech MX Keys Mini: Choose this path if your real day is constant device switching. Run one live test block: swap between laptop, tablet, and phone while doing actual work, then check whether switching and typing rhythm stay stable. Limitation: if that flow breaks in practice, the convenience case weakens fast.
Logitech Keys-To-Go 2: Put this on your list when transit friction is the main problem you need to solve. It suits high-mobility days where packability matters every hour. Limitation: the same slim profile that helps portability may be less forgiving in longer writing sessions.
Lofree Flow / Keychron K series: Consider these when typing feel directly affects your output quality over long blocks. A realistic scenario is a writing or coding-heavy day where key consistency matters more than absolute compactness. Limitation: portability and shared-space comfort can drop if your chosen model is heavier, louder, or layout-specific.
Apple Magic Keyboard: This is the clearest fit when your iPad is truly your main machine on the road. It works best in a single, consistent device workflow rather than frequent cross-device jumping. Limitation: if iPad is secondary in your setup, it can become a narrower tool than you need.

It matters when you regularly work in dim hotel rooms, flights, or low-light coworking spaces. Not every portable keyboard includes backlit keys, so check the current spec sheet rather than assuming it is standard. If you mostly work in daylight, you may value lower weight or simpler charging more.
Often yes, especially if your bag is packed tightly with chargers, stands, and hard-edged gear. A case or integrated cover can add protection in transit, but there is a tradeoff. Some protected designs feel bulkier or less comfortable, so check both the carrying profile and the typing angle before you buy.
